My child comes first, says Carlos Delgado
"My child comes first," stated New York Mets first baseman Carlos Delgado. The 34-year-old’s wife, Betzaida,is expecting the couple’s first child, a son, on April 1st, the same day as the team’s season opener.
"I will express to the Mets my intentions to be there," he said. "Like any other father in the world, I want to be there for that great day." Jay Horwitz, Mets’ spokesperson, expects there to be no problems.
We’re aware that his wife is having a baby and whatever he needs to do to take care of the family, that’s what he’ll do. It’s always been the Mets’ policy when one of our players has a baby, no matter what time of the year it is, he’s always permitted to spend time with his wife and new baby.
The couple’s new child will be named Carlos Antonio.
